- The word 'Bunnahabhain' means river mouth. Bunnahabhain was build in 1881 by the Greenless Brothers and is still the most norther Distillery on the Isle of Islay. Read more about it below.↓
The Bunnahabhain Whiskies are lightly peated Islay Malts that have a lot of salty marine tones. The distillery bottling range has many Whiskies ranging from the 12-year-old to the 40-year-old. There are also a few no age bottlings that have different tastes.
There are many independent bottlings of the Bunnahabhain distillery.
